This appointment includes but is not limited to:
- The participant assists the Army Wellness Center (AWC) with the delivery of six core programs (i.e., health assessment review, physical fitness, healthy nutrition, stress management, general wellness education, and tobacco education).
- Assist the operation with tasks such as coordination of community events, scheduling appointments, supply management, equipment maintenance, This position provides support for the Health and Nurse Educator and AWC Director.
-Must possess above average organization skills, ability to plan, coordinate, and manage complex requests to that support the AWC and community.
- Must have excellent customer service skills, capable of taking direction for others and the ability to function well in a fast paced team environment.

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S
Local Candidates Only. Applicants should have recently completed a bachelors or a master's degree within five years of the desired starting date in Public Health, Health Education, Allied Health or related discipline, or will be able to complete of all requirements for the degree within six months of the starting date. Other applicants will be considered on a case-by-case basis. The program is open to all qualified U.S. citizens without regard to race, sex, religion, color, age, physical or mental disability, national origin, or status as a Vietnam era or disabled veteran.

GENERAL INFORMATION
The participants will be selected based on academic records, recommendations, applied research interests and compatibility of background with applied research programs and projects at the host Installation. The initial appointment is for one year and may be renewed for up to four additional years based upon recommendation of the host installation and subject to availability of funds. The appointment is full time at the host installation.
The participant will receive a monthly stipend. The stipend rate is determined based upon level of education, training, and experience. Inbound travel and moving expenses are reimbursed according to established policies. Travel and other costs will also be reimbursed for training related to the project and approved by ORISE and the host installation. The participant must show proof of health and medical insurance. Health plans are available through the Oak Ridge Institute for Science and Education for Postgraduate Internship participants. The appointment is full time at the host installation.
